Number 24 is fairly difficult here in comparison to a regular game. Bosses with Regen tend to be that way thanks to the fact that any time I spend messing around ends up costing me damage instead of gaining some from Seizure. However, just like in a regular game, Number 24 gives an incredibly large number of free turns. He spends half the time Wallchanging and failing to attack with Overflow, and then spends maybe 2/3 of his remaining turns using Runicable spells. And on my winning attempt, I get even luckier than the average, so he spends almost all of the battle doing absolutely nothing. After the first part of the battle where I get set up, he hits me with only two or three attacks the entire time, which Gau heals quickly with Dried Meats/Remedies. I could have certainly handled a great deal more punishment than that, however.

I don't Rage Gau because Celes can't heal thanks to the fact that she is too busy with Runic. Edgar would be a poor choice for a dedicated healer. Locke and Gau do similar damage on average, but I can't tell Gau to slow down the offense if I am worried for his safety, so Locke is my choice to attack and Gau is my choice to spam Meat. Oh, and Brawler has a nasty Poison weakness, so Acid Rain is too dangerous when using it. Going Conjurer would slow my offense considerably, as I'd only have Edgar for dedicated offense, so it is going too far defensively considering that characters don't die often with Runic in place. So the best Rage to use is in fact no Rage at all.
